Biology A-level covers the following topics, and is similar to previous AS, A-Level courses run in previous years: Content: YEAR 1 and AS: 1.Biological molecules 2. Cells 3. Organisms exchange substances with their environment 4. Genetic information, variation and relationships between organisms YEAR 2 and A-Level: 5. Energy transfers in and between organisms 6. Organisms respond to changes in their internal and external environments 7. Genetics, populations, evolution and ecosystems 8. The control of gene expression The changes in assessment are as follows: AS Biology is one year long, with exams at the end. A-level Biology lasts two years, with exams at the end of the second year. Required practical content is tracked in school and approved through AQA.
Name: AS and A-level Biology Qualification title: - Qualification type: GCE A/AS Level or equivalent Assessment AS – 100% external exam. Two, 1.5 hour papers, comprising 50% each of AS grade total. They cover a mixture of content from the AS course (topics 1-4). A-Level – 100% external exam. Three, 2 hour papers. First covers AS content, worth 35%. Second covers A-level content, worth 35%. A final paper, worth 30% covers experimental context question, and also includes an extended writing essay question. Awarding - Created 20161031 14:24:29 Updated 20161031 14:27:00
